Postby Toy1mzfe » Tue Apr 27, 2010 1:54 am

With 8.5 rears you need an offset of 35. With rolled fenders or shaved fenders ur good.

But even with this setup its not hellaflush. I would rather work with 8.5 at 215. then maybe an offset of....25

and camber accordingly. But u gots to have coilovers.

Postby K1llertwo » Mon May 03, 2010 10:56 am

I don't rub anymore, i properly rolled the fenders ( to a 90 degree roll) before i had it at45 degrees. I take a sheet of paper, put it between the fender and the tire, start bouncing the car and the paper never gets stuck: im not rubbing anymore even when i drive hard. anyways, ive got a camber kit coming in too...
